Togli quegli apici
select DATE_FORMAT(Data_Appuntamento,'%Y') as data_formattata, COUNT( * ) as num
from tabella
GROUP BY data_formattata
Puoi anche usare la funzione year
select year(Data_Appuntamento) as anno, COUNT(*) as num
from tabella
GROUP BY anno